Pope Francis makes a public appearance at a window of Rome’s Gemelli Hospital on Sunday, March 23. He was discharged that day from the hospital, where he had been battling pneumonia in both of his lungs. Though the Pope looked frail and struggled to speak, he addressed the crowd outside the hospital, thanking them and acknowledging one woman in the crowd who was holding flowers. He also gave a blessing, though he appeared to have some difficulty raising his arms.

Hamdan Ballal, the Palestinian director of the Oscar-winning documentary “No Other Land,” is released from a police station in the West Bank settlement of Kiryat Arba on Tuesday, March 25. The day before, Ballal was attacked by a mob of Israeli settlers in front of his home in the village of Susya. Afterward, he and two other Palestinians were taken away by Israeli soldiers and detained. The Israeli military accused Ballal of throwing stones at soldiers and said that he had been detained on suspicion of rock hurling, property damage and endangering regional security. Ballal disputes the military’s interpretation of the events. Attacks on Palestinian farmers and activists in the occupied West Bank are not new. But the ferocity of the attack – and Ballal’s subsequent detention – made him feel that the settlers – and the Israeli military – were taking revenge for the film and its international reach, he told CNN.

A wildfire spreads along mountain slopes in Uiseong, South Korea, on Monday, March 24. South Korea is struggling to contain wildfires ravaging the country’s southeast after more than two dozen blazes broke out over the weekend.

Firefighters extinguish a fire at the North Hyde electrical substation in Hayes, England, on Friday, March 21. The fire disrupted the local power supply, causing a shutdown at nearby Heathrow Airport that affected hundreds of flights around the world.

American skiing legend Lindsey Vonn celebrates her second-place finish in a World Cup super-G race in Sun Valley, Idaho, on Sunday, March 23. The podium spot concluded Vonn’s comeback season at the age of 40. She came out of retirement this season after a partial knee replacement.

A woman takes a photograph of the empty spot where a painting of President Donald Trump used to be at the Colorado State Capitol in Denver on Tuesday, March 25. The painting, which was hanging with other presidential portraits, was taken down after Trump claimed that his was “purposefully distorted,” according to a letter obtained by The Associated Press.
